The fly maggots drop to the ground on long, gel-like threads. Protozoan parasites such as Ophryocystis elektroscirrha and a microsporidian Nosema species have been reported to infect both wild and captive monarch butterflies. Only two bird species prey significantly on monarchs, even though there are 37 insectivorous and omnivorous bird species in the region. When they are caterpillars, monarchs eat milkweeds that contain toxins called "cardenolides." display: none; 2007). When a parasitized caterpillar hangs upside down in the pre-pupal “J”-shape, several tachinid fly larvae or maggots will come out of the monarch caterpillar.
